Silver; Standard, 20 3-lGd; hue, 25 5-10 d per m. SYDNEY WOOL SALES. Press Association—By Telegraph—Copyright. SIDNEY, February 21. At the wool .sales competition was attain spirited in all sections, and prices were firm at best late rates. MELBOURNE WOOL SALKS. Press Association—By Telegraph—Copyright MELBOURNE, February 21. At the wool sales there was strong general competition in all sections. Merinos wore firm at late rates, and comebacks and cross-breds ol all grades showed an upward tendency, particularly the coarser sorts, which readied the highest point of the season.
